Output 651ea3d301d3a4db21235c3ac7d54dbd8140a2e637dd0603c8512143b194710e:1

value
162190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c9771cad49a3975eddaab40ccee76642dc00ce2 OP_EQUAL
address
32qbTPp84ytSjtoHQ7Kz22DiikD25QtQG8
transaction
651ea3d301d3a4db21235c3ac7d54dbd8140a2e637dd0603c8512143b194710e
confirmations
364191
spent
true